Inside Chicago’s surveillance panopticon
On the morning of September 2, 2024, a horrific mass shooting occurred on a Chicago Transit Authority Blue Line train, resulting in the deaths of four individuals as the train approached the suburb of Forest Park. In response, the police activated a digital dragnet, a surveillance network that connects thousands of cameras and sensors to quickly locate suspects and gather evidence. This incident sparked widespread discussion about urban surveillance technology, particularly regarding the balance between public safety and privacy rights. As technology continues to advance, the effectiveness and ethics of surveillance systems have become focal points of public concern. The event not only highlighted the potential of surveillance technology in responding to emergencies but also prompted reflection on the risks of its misuse.
